Ingredients:

  • 750 ml Dry Red Wine (Tempranillo or Garnacha)
  • 120 ml Spanish Brandy
  • 60 ml Orange Liqueur (Cointreau or Grand Marnier)
  • 1 large Orange, half sliced into rounds and half juiced
  • 1 medium Lemon, sliced into rounds
  • 1 crisp Green Apple, cored and chopped into small cubes
  • 2 tbsp Granulated Sugar
  • 250 ml Sparkling Water or Club Soda
  • Fresh Mint sprigs
  • Large ice cubes

Instructions:

  1. Prep the fruit. Core and chop the green apple into 1 cm cubes.
  2. Slice the citrus. Cut half the orange and the whole lemon into thin rounds.
  3. Juice the orange. Squeeze the remaining half orange into a large glass pitcher.
  4. Dissolve the sugar. Add 2 tbsp sugar to the orange juice and stir until the liquid looks clear and no grains remain.
  5. Fortify the base. Pour in 120 ml brandy and 60 ml orange liqueur.
  6. Macerate the fruit. Toss in the apples, orange slices, and lemon slices, stirring to coat.
  7. Add the wine. Pour in the 750 ml of dry red wine and stir gently.
  8. The cold cure. Refrigerate for 4 hours until the color deepens and the aroma is intoxicating.
  9. The final spritz. Just before serving, pour in 250 ml sparkling water.
  10. Garnish and serve. Fill glasses with large ice, pour the mixture, and top with a fresh mint sprig.
